      <description>This padlet captures a number talk focused on the 7th grade standard 7.EE.A.1: applying properties of operations, including the distributive property, to simplify numerical expressions . Students explored mental strategies to simplify expressions like 5(12+3). The padletwill include student strategies , visuals, and follow-up discussion questions.</description>

         <title>Discussion Questions </title>
         <author>kbrown7_20</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/kbrown7_20/h55ea1lpuj0ysm7q/wish/3459798690</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ul><li><p>What strategy did you use?</p></li><li><p>Can someone solve it in a different way?</p></li><li><p>how do you know your answer is correct?</p></li><li><p>why does the distributive property work?</p></li><li><p>what connections can you make between strategies?</p></li></ul>]]></description>
